碩士 === 高雄醫學大學 === 藥學研究所碩士在職專班 === 93 === The combination of Fluorouracil (5-Fu) and Folinic acid (Leucovorin) is the first line regiment for colorectal caner. Sometimes these two drugs are mixed in the same container for the convenience of using in our hospital. In addition, patients can be treated with multiple days continuous infusion without hospitalized, because of the progressing medical supplies. However, the study has shown that these two drugs are physically incompatible. Furthermore, more studies have showed that the particles of injections are potentially harmful for body. The pharmacopoeias in many countries have made a precise standard for the particles in large volume parenterals (LVPs). The U.S.P. also has made a precise standard for small volume parenterals (SVPs) recently, but it is performed by HIAC® method. Meanwhile, the Chinese pharmacopoeia does not make up a standard for SVPs yet.
The aim of this study was to detect the particulate contaminant of samples by Coulter Counter®. The concentrations of 5-Fu and Leucovorin were based on the clinical dosage. The data of the particulate count were collected after four hours of preparing and determination of the count of particles was carried out from second day to seventh day.
According to the assumption of “One-Fifth Theory” and the standard for LVPs in Chinese pharmacopoeia, patients can endure the consequence in particular situation. Moreover, medical staffs can care their patients more effectively and patients’ hospitalization both frequency and duration can be reduced. Finally, the goal of this study is that medical staffs can provide high efficiency medical service and patients can have a higher quality of medical attention.
